Output 596125040cda041b938512c7e05bee19bdbfa6f627c17820ac7f9f0240799f21:0

value
3308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8cf5937fa165e8917083cba2a9a7d7d53b5b30ad3ebc1196e6aff6b09daddf66
address
ltc1p3n6exlapvh5fzuyrew32nf7h65a4kv9d867pr9hx4lmtp8ddmanq0jxtp9
transaction
596125040cda041b938512c7e05bee19bdbfa6f627c17820ac7f9f0240799f21
spent
true